Ctenanthe lubbersiana aka Never Never Plant
Taxonomy ID: 282
Ctenanthe lubbersiana, also known as the bamburanta, is a species of flowering plant in the genus Ctenanthe. Native to tropical Brazil, it belongs to the Marantaceae family and is closely related to the calathea and prayer plant. This evergreen perennial is primarily grown for its stunning and colorful leaves. It has gained recognition from the Royal Horticultural Society, receiving the Award of Garden Merit as a subtropical hothouse ornamental.
Growing up to 2 meters in height, Ctenanthe lubbersiana features branched stems that bear oblong deep green leaves, which are beautifully mottled and streaked with yellow on the upper surface and paler below. It is one of the three Ctenanthe species that make excellent houseplants, alongside C. oppenheimiana and C. burle-marxii.
Ctenanthe oppenheimiana, also called the 'Never Never Plant,' can reach a height of 3 feet and produces lance-shaped leaves that are dark green with silver bands. Its foliage showcases maroon undersides, and the Tricolor variety of C. oppenheimiana offers even more vibrant colors. On the other hand, C. burle-marxii is a smaller and more compact plant, featuring silver-gray elliptical leaves with green stripes.
While these Ctenanthe plants are visually appealing, they require a bit more care and attention. They are considered mildly poisonous, although often listed as non-toxic. It is important to note that they may cause individual allergic reactions and should be kept away from pets and children.

What are the water needs for Never Never Plant
Never Never Plant should be watered regularly, allowing the soil to dry out between waterings.
What is the right soil for Never Never Plant
Never Never Plant loves a well-draining soil. Perlite and vermiculite help with drainage, while coco coir adds organic matter, so a good potting soil mix will have all three. You can improve store-bought soil by adding some perlite to it.
What is the sunlight requirement for Never Never Plant
To ensure optimal growth, the Never Never Plant prefers bright indirect light for 6-8 hours each day. Insufficient light can result in slow growth and leaf drop, so it's important to find a well-lit location for this plant. Place it near a window, within a distance of 1 meter (3 feet), to enhance its potential for thriving.

What is the growth pattern of Never Never Plant
New growth will sprout from the top of the Never Never Plant as it grows vertically.
Is Never Never Plant flowering?
Yes, if you provide your Never Never Plant with adequate sunlight and water, you can expect it to bloom.
